Troy Ethan Wilson (born November 22, 1970) is an American former professional football defensive lineman who played in the National Football League (NFL). Wilson had a seven-year career playing defensive end for the San Francisco 49ers, Denver Broncos, New Orleans Saints, and Chicago Bears.

Wilson attended Pittsburg State University from 1989 to 1992, helping Pittsburg State win the 1991 NCAA Division II national championship.[1]

He was selected by the 49ers in the seventh round (194th overall) of the 1993 NFL draft.[2] Wilson was a member of the 49ers Super Bowl championship team in 1994.[1]

Wilson played for the Tampa Bay Storm in the Arena Football League (AFL) in 2002 and 2003. He was a member of the 2003 Arena Bowl championship team.[1]
